Ingalls Elementary School, located at 100 Bulldog Dr in Ingalls, KS, is a reputable educational institution that caters to students from Pre-Kindergarten through 5th grade. In terms of financial commitment, Ingalls Elementary School demonstrates responsible management of resources. As of November 26, 2023, the school's expenditures per student amount to $7717.00, reflecting a dedication to providing a well-rounded education while efficiently utilizing available funds.
